Advancement in this profession typically comes with increased education and experience. Horticultural therapists may advance by moving into management positions, and overseeing the work of other therapists on staff. Some advance by adding consulting to their current responsibilities. Others consider it an advancement to move into consulting full time. Still others move into teaching at schools offering horticultural therapy programs.
